Shubunkin Queen
Late january this year we got three comet fish and put them in our pond in the back yard. With lillies and duck weed etc. They feed mostly on mosquito lava, plants and flake food. The fish in the pond are 1 gold and 2 shubunkins and they where fairly small.

Over the last 2 weeks we have had rain and just now we have just checked the pond and have noticed fry at about the size of a small red cloud minnow with shubunkin pattern. Not sure how many are in there but we have noticed 4 fry in there. biggrin.gif

Have no idea how old they are. blink.gif

Shubunkin Queen
Update the fry i reported two weeks ago there are 8 two have shubunkin markings the other 6 are a brown colour and all have grown.

Today we saw some more fry smaller than the 8 bigger ones, and i have a feeling the adults have spawned again.

In the pond we have 3 adults, 2 shubunkins and a orange coloured fish. We got them in late January this year and the 3 were an inch long. We are now in May, and one of the shubunkins is now 5 inches long, the other shubunkin about 3 inches long and the orange one about the same.

I would love to take pics of the fry, but its hard to they love the sun so thats when they come out of hiding.
